Originally from Kwara State but born in Kano, Nigeria, Aduke kicked off her gospel music journey at a young age and has turned it into a heartfelt mission to spread God’s word through her songs.
Her passion for gospel music ignited in the mid-1980s when she joined a choir, eventually taking on leadership roles in various choirs. This drive to convey God’s message through music has been the heartbeat of her ministry.
Throughout her career, she has put out several musical projects, including ‘Oru Mbo (The Night Cometh),’ ‘I Dance,’ ‘Mould Me,’ ‘We Worship You,’ ‘Eru Kosi,’ ‘Nagode,’ ‘Light of Life,’ ‘Emi A Duro,’ and ‘Mo Gbe Jesu De EP.’
Aduke’s music is a beautiful mix of contemporary and traditional gospel, worship, and praise. She has a unique talent for crafting songs that touch people's hearts, helping them connect with God while blending both classic and modern worship styles.
